1.0 Introduction
The Nuaire MRXBOX90L (Large) heat recovery unit has an efficiency
of 90% and energy saving constant volume fan. The unit is supplied
with a nearly 100% bypass, which can be used to interrupt the heat
recovery, if desired, to supplied fresh, cool outside air. The heat
exchanger is equipped with a sliding grate that shuts off the airflow
through the exchanger.
The unit has the following functions:
• steplessly adjustable air flow rates through a control panel
• filter indication on the unit
• frost protection system that ensures optimum performance
of the unit, even at very low atmospheric temperatures
• the unit comes ready for use
• all control equipment has been mounted and checked in the
factory
• on installation, the appliance must be connected to the air
ducts, the condensate discharge, the mains supply and the
multiple switch
• the installer can change the desired air flow for every setting
with the aid of the control panel on the unit
1.1 Function components
1.
Interior temperature sensor measures the temperature of the air
from the dwelling.
2. Heat exchanger ensures heat transfer between inlet and outlet air.
3. Filters filter both air flows.
4. Atmospheric temperature sensor measures outside air temperature.
5. Communication connection port for cable to multiple switch.
6. Swivel plate fitted with swivels for feeding through 230V cable.
7.
Open Therm connection two pole connector for Open Therm control.
8. Option pcb between user and control electronics.
9. Inlet fan feeds fresh air into the dwelling.
